What is High-Grade Serous Carcinoma
Imagine hearing the term ‘High-Grade Serous Carcinoma’ (HGSC) for the first time. Sounds intimidating, doesn’t it? Let’s break it down.

HGSC is essentially a form of epithelial Ovarian Cancer, a type of cancer that starts in the cells on the surface of the ovaries. Now, among the various kinds of ovarian cancers, HGSC stands out. Why? It’s because it’s the most commonly diagnosed ovarian cancer. But there’s a catch: it’s also the most aggressive.

Stages of Ovarian Tumors

Cancer isn’t a one-size-fits-all disease. Like a story, it has stages, each depicting the progression of the disease:
Stage 1: The Beginning – A Hushed Whisper

In its initial stage, cancer is somewhat like a character quietly introduced into a story. It remains localized, limited to its birthplace, which in this context, would be one or both ovaries. It’s present, but its presence is subtle, not fully revealing its intentions.

Stage 2: The Rising Action – Exploring Beyond Boundaries
As the story progresses, our antagonist becomes a bit bolder. The cancer starts to explore, extending its influence to nearby realms, specifically other parts of the pelvis. The plot begins to thicken, suggesting a change in the storyline.

Stage 3: The Tension Builds – Into Uncharted Territories

By the Third Stage, the Cancer Seeks a Bigger Role in the narrative. It’s not just about exploration anymore; it’s about conquest. It ventures into significant landmarks, such as the abdominal lining or the lymph Nodes, the guardians of our immune system. This audacious move sets the stage for more dramatic events to unfold.

Stage 4: Climactic Revelation – The Farthest Frontier

Arriving at this stage feels like the crescendo of a symphony. The cancer, now emboldened, travels to distant lands within the body, marking the peak of its audacity. It’s a defining moment, demanding immediate and intensive countermeasures.

Treatment Modalities: Navigating the Path Ahead

Ovarian tumors, like many other cancers, have a spectrum. On one end, there are low-grade tumors that grow slowly and might not require aggressive treatment. On the other end are high-grade tumors that are more aggressive and often necessitate more comprehensive treatment plans.

  • Chemotherapy:
    Chemotherapy is like that rainstorm which can erode even the steepest terrains. For those with low-grade stage 1 ovarian tumors, the storm might be unnecessary. Their landscape can often be navigated without much intervention. However, when it comes to the challenging terrains of high-grade tumors, chemotherapy often plays a pivotal role.

Using a powerful concoction of drugs, chemotherapy aims to dismantle the cancer stronghold, either by killing the rogue cells or halting their rebellion. The decision to embark on this stormy journey depends on several factors: the ferocity of the tumor (its grade), how far it has spread (its stage), and the unique circumstances and health of the individual.

  • Surgical Intervention

Before any other steps are taken, surgery often acts as the first responder. Think of it as clearing a blocked path or building a bridge over a difficult stretch. In the case of HGSC, this involves removing the tumor, offering a direct and often effective way to address the cancer.

But here’s the thing: surgery often doesn’t walk alone. It’s frequently accompanied by its trusted ally – chemotherapy. After the path is cleared, chemotherapy ensures the landscape remains navigable, free from any remnants that might pose challenges in the future.
